Introduction to Anti-lock Braking System

1,BackgroundABS system were first developed for aeroplanes in 1929, by the French car and plane pioneer, Gabriel Voisin, as threshold braking an airline is just about hopeless. However, a restrictedform of anti lock braking, utilizing a valve which could adjust front to rear brake drive distribution when a wheel secured, was fitted to the 1964 Austin 1800.Chrysler, as well as the Bendix Corporation, released a crude, restricted production ABS System on the 1971 Imperial. Called “Sure Brake”, it was readily available for a few yrs, and had a satisfactory functioning and record of reliability. Ford also presented anti lock brakes on the Lincoln Continental Mark III and the Ford LTD station wagon, called “Sure Trak”. The German corporations Bosch and Mercedes-Benz had been co-developing techhnology of ABS since the 1930s, and launched the first utterly electronic 4-wheel multiple channels Anti-lock Braking System in vans and the Mercedes-Benz S-Class in 1978. The Electronic control unit incessantly screens the rotational speed of each wheel. When it senses that any number of wheels are rotating substantially slower than the others (a situation that is apt to bring it to lck – see note below), it actuates the valves to lower the pressure on the specific braking circuit for the personal wheel, efficiently reducing the braking drive on that wheel. The wheel(s) then turn faster; when they turn too quickly, the power is reapplied. This process is repeated constantly, and this results in the attribute pulsing feel through the brake pedal. A typical anti-lock program can implement and launch braking pressure almost twenty times a second.Note: The Electronic control unit must decide when some of the wheels turn considerably slower than any of the others for the reason that when the car is turning the two wheels in direction of the core of the curve inherently move a little bit slower than the other two C which is the main reason why a differential is used in virtually all professional motors.The devices can come to be degraded with metal dust, or other pollutants, and fail to correctly detect wheel slip; this is not generally picked up by the internal ABS controller diagnostic. In this case, the Anti-lock braking system signal light will normally be illuminated on the instrument panel, and the ABS will be disabled until the fault is rectified.
